Pipeline Integrity mapping, Pennsylvania

Using sUAS based imaging technology to produce weekly maps of 200 miles of pipeline every week in Pennsylvania. This allows environmental inspectors to have “eyes on” every inch of their project for responsible management of critical infrastructure.

water leak detection, Permian basin, Texas

Using sUAS based thermal technology to detect water leaks in water transfer lines in Texas. Thermal anomalies proven for the detection of even small amounts of liquid loss.

Stockpile Volumetrics, West Virginia

Accurate volumetrics using 3D point cloud technology allow our clients to gauge and verify their quantities in stockpiles.

Lidar Surveys, Pennsylvania

Using sUAS based Lidar units to precision map a section of State Game Lands in central Pennsylvania.

 

Crash Scene Simulation, North Carolina

Working in conjunction with RTI International and NCDOT to demonstrate the use of Unmanned Aerial Vehicles in Crash Scene Investigation. This is video of a simulated crash scene in which a vehicle collides with a light pick-up truck carrying passengers in the cargo bed.

Search and Rescue Simulation, Pennsylvania

When time is crucial sUAS technology saves lives. Being able to quickly deploy technology and respond to emergencies can make all the difference. With thermal payloads responders have “eyes in the dark” to see what can’t be seen even with the best lights. Unmanned Aerial Vehicles are much safer in hazardous situations and keep the risk of human casualties much lower.

Wind Turbine inspection, Pennsylvania

Keeping clean energy sources functioning at their fullest potential is critical. Using a laser scaling system we are able to inspect damage areas on wind turbine blades quickly and efficiently with minimal shutdown and maximum safety.
